IX2 — short for Interactions 2.0 — is Webflow's built-in animation engine. It allows designers and developers to create complex, multi-step animations and interactions entirely through a visual interface, without writing a single line of JavaScript or CSS animation code.
IX2 operates through a system of triggers and timelines. Triggers define when an animation starts — on page load, on scroll, on hover, on click, or when an element enters the viewport. Timelines let you sequence multiple animation steps, controlling properties like opacity, position, scale, rotation, color, and size over time. Scroll-based animations tie visual effects to the user's scroll position, enabling techniques like parallax, reveal-on-scroll, and progress indicators. All animations are previewed in real time within the Webflow Designer.
IX2 powers a wide range of web experiences: animated hero sections, interactive navigation menus, scroll-driven storytelling, hover micro-interactions, loading animations, and dynamic content reveals. Because it generates optimized CSS transforms and JavaScript under the hood, IX2 animations are performant and work across modern browsers and devices.
